Header Ads Widget

Ticker

6/recent/ticker-posts

Cómo verificar la conectividad del puerto TCP / UDP por telnet / netcat

Yo: instalo telnet netcat

Ia: Instale telnet netcat en Linux:

1
2
yum install nc -y
yum install telnet -y

Ib: Instalar telnet netcat en Windows:
Cómo instalar netcat en Windows
Cómo instalar el cliente telnet en Windows Server 2008

II: Comprobación de la conectividad del puerto TCP

II.a: Comprobación de la conectividad del puerto TCP con telnet

1
telnet hostname/IP-address port-number

Ejemplo de conexión exitosa:

1
C:\Users\Administrator>telnet 127.0.0.1 11211

Ejemplo de conexión fallida:

1
2
3
C:\Users\Administrator>telnet 127.0.0.1 22
Connecting To 127.0.0.1...Could not open connection to the host, on port 22: Con
nect failed

II.b: Comprobación de la conectividad del puerto TCP con netcat

1
nc -z -v hostname/IP-address port-number

Ejemplo de conexión exitosa:

1
2
$ nc -z -v 127.0.0.1 11211
Connection to 127.0.0.1 11211 port [tcp/*] succeeded!

Ejemplo de conexión fallida:

1
2
$ nc -z -v 127.0.0.1 81
nc: connect to 127.0.0.1 port 81 (tcp) failed: Connection refused

III: Verificación de la conectividad del puerto UDP (por netcat)

1
nc -z -v -u hostname/IP-address port-number

Ejemplo de conexión exitosa:

1
2
$ nc -z -v -u 192.168.1.27 4444
Connection to 192.168.1.27 4444 port [udp/*] succeeded!

Verifique el servidor UDP que vemos:

1
2
Data received from client : X
Received 1 bytes from 192.168.1.27:50394

Publicar un comentario

0 Comentarios